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Manchester to Cheddar is to bus and line 376 bus which costs £23 - £40 and takes 6h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Manchester to Cheddar is to drive which takes 3h 26m and costs £45 - £65.
No, there is no direct bus from Manchester to Cheddar. However, there are services departing from Manchester, Shudehill Interchange and arriving at Church Street via Bus Station and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 40m.
No, there is no direct train from Manchester to Cheddar. However, there are services departing from Manchester Piccadilly and arriving at Yatton via Bristol Temple Meads.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h.
The distance between Manchester and Cheddar is 194 miles. The road distance is 185.2 miles.
The best way to get from Manchester to Cheddar without a car is to train which takes 4h and costs £120 - £170.
It takes approximately 4h to get from Manchester to Cheddar, including transfers.
Manchester to Cheddar b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Manchester, Shudehill Interchange station.
Manchester to Cheddar train services, operated by Cross Country, depart from Manchester Piccadilly station.
The best way to get from Manchester to Cheddar is to train which takes 4h and costs £120 - £170. Alternatively, you can bus and line 376 bus, which costs £23 - £40 and takes 6h 40m, you could also fly, which costs £75 - £170 and takes 4h 37m.
